Founded in 1989 by Charles Casanova, Atermes initially focused on industrial cooperation, combining expertise in mechanical, electronic, optronic and software design. Driven by its founder’s vision, the company quickly developed its sales activities in export markets. Today, under the leadership of Lionel Thomas and with the continued support of Charles Casanova, Atermes operates across several locations: Montigny-le-Bretonneux, its engineering center in France; Salbris, its manufacturing center in France; Lyon, its software and artificial intelligence laboratory in France; and Dubai, its MENA operations headquarters in the United Arab Emirates.
